Game Introduction

Embark on a thrilling escape in Drunk Escape! This exhilarating game challenges you to leap over charming obstacles, a task made all the more urgent by the grumpy Nievita, eager to scratch you with his thorny branches. Following your escape from Dracula's daughter (beta version), Drunk finds himself in a snowy wonderland, where he creates a snowman he playfully names Nievita. However, Dracula breathes life into this frosty creation, setting Nievita on a relentless pursuit of Drunk.

Throughout your perilous journey, you'll encounter a red panda, a bookish friend who encourages your escape. But beware! This seemingly cute creature dislikes physical contact.

Your mood, much like Drunk's, is ever-changing. Express yourself with new avatars that react to your touch, mirroring your daily feelings.

Personalization: Customize your look, skateboard design, and victory celebrations! Collect 150 coins to unlock the Season Pass, granting access to 12 rewards. The in-game store offers additional celebrations, avatars, and skateboards for purchase.

Coin Collection: Earn 20 coins per successful escape, collect coins through the Season Pass, and grab up to 5 coins daily by tapping the "FREE" icon on the home screen.
